Chief Executive candidate John Lee is expected to announce his manifesto on Friday morning.

Sources told RTHK on Wednesday that the policy platform will be released at a press conference at the Convention Centre at 11am.

A deputy director of Lee's campaign office, Raymond Tam, said the manifesto has "basically been completed".

Tam was speaking to reporters as he continued collecting policy proposals from different groups.

He said the proposals received covered health issues, as well as housing and land supply.
